While the Biden administration did pass the Inflation Reduction Act, which included a number of important climate crisis-related stipulations, critics are calling on the White House to stop taking actions that further embed U.S. dependency on fossil fuels. Several lawmakers, including Senators Bernie Sanders , Ed Markey , Jeff Merkley and Elizabeth Warren , signed an open letter last monthfor spending years lying about the reality of climate change, alleging that their actions were illegal and a violation of the public’s trust.
